Cumberlands Wins MSC Women's Golf Title in Comeback Fashion

4/28/2026 10:30:00 PM

BOWLING GREEN, Ky. -- Cumberlands (Ky.) overcame a two-stroke deficit to capture the 2026 Mid-South Conference Women's Golf Tournament championship on Tuesday at Bowling Green County Club. 

With the victory, the Patriots earned the conference's automatic bid in the NAIA Women's Golf National Championship.

Cumberlands posted the best round of the tournament (307) in today's final round to win by four shots over Cumberland (Tenn.) and five over Lindsey Wilson (Ky.)

Cumberlands’ finished the two-day event with a team-total 933 (312-314-307). Cumberland finished runner-up with a 937 (313-314-310), while Lindsey Wilson was third with a 938 (310-314-314). 

Lindsey Wilson's Kayla Saunders took home the individual title with a 215 (74-75-74). With the medalist honor, Saunders earns an automatic bid into the NAIA National Championship next month.

Cumberland’s Crystal Zamzow finished in second, shooting a 227 (76-76-75), and Cumberlands’ Atchariya Thanaudomkul finished in third with a 229 (74-79-76).

Bethel (Tenn.) ended in fourth place in the team standings with a 970 (321-322-327), followed by Freed-Hardeman's (Tenn.) 974 (321-322-327). Campbellsville (Ky.) ended in sixth at 1,019 (347-340-332), while Georgetown (Ky.) rounds out the standings at 1,028 (345-343-340).

With their wins, Cumberlands and Saunders advance to the NAIA National Championships May 12-15, at Eagle Crest Golf Club in Ypsilanti, Michigan.
